Output c95f21ea6ac1d927a42f38f2bcb7f36616bebcb9f642db810e1d23dc398965a4:9

value
172697682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4efbe538c2c1863ed6bd703ff4616369a420bb41 OP_EQUAL
address
38tePWGyUekPFJvb4evsJDcW6DJV6W6obH
transaction
c95f21ea6ac1d927a42f38f2bcb7f36616bebcb9f642db810e1d23dc398965a4
spent
true